引言
随着互联网技术的飞速发展,web前端开发已经成为了一个热门的领域。对于初学者来说,选择一个合适的web前端课程并掌握实战技巧至关重要。本文将深入探讨web前端课程的内容,分析教科书中的实战技巧,并通过案例分析帮助读者更好地理解这些技巧。
一、web前端课程概述
1. 课程内容
web前端课程通常包括以下几个方面的内容:
- HTML/CSS基础:学习网页的基本结构和样式设计。
- JavaScript基础:掌握JavaScript语言,实现动态交互效果。
- 前端框架:了解和使用主流的前端框架,如React、Vue、Angular等。
- 版本控制:学习使用Git等版本控制系统。
- 响应式设计:掌握响应式布局,使网页适应不同设备。
2. 课程目标
通过学习web前端课程,学员应达到以下目标:
- 掌握HTML、CSS、JavaScript等基础技能。
- 熟悉主流前端框架的使用。
- 具备解决实际问题的能力。
- 具备团队协作和沟通能力。
二、教科书中的实战技巧
1. 代码规范
在编写代码时,遵循一定的规范可以使代码更加易于阅读和维护。以下是一些常见的代码规范:
- 使用一致的命名规则。
- 空格和缩进的使用。
- 注释的编写。
2. 模块化设计
将代码划分为模块,可以提高代码的可读性和可维护性。以下是一些模块化设计的技巧:
- 使用函数封装功能。
- 使用类封装对象。
- 使用模块化框架。
3. 优化性能
在开发过程中,关注网页的性能至关重要。以下是一些优化性能的技巧:
- 减少HTTP请求。
- 压缩图片和CSS/JavaScript文件。
- 使用浏览器缓存。
三、案例分析
1. 项目背景
某公司开发了一款在线教育平台,需要实现用户注册、登录、课程浏览等功能。
2. 技术选型
- 前端:React框架
- 后端:Node.js
- 数据库:MySQL
3. 实战技巧应用
- 使用React框架构建用户注册和登录界面。
- 使用axios进行前后端数据交互。
- 使用CSS预处理器Sass进行样式设计。
- 使用Webpack进行代码打包和优化。
4. 项目成果
通过实战练习,学员掌握了以下技能:
- 使用React框架进行前端开发。
- 实现前后端数据交互。
- 使用CSS预处理器进行样式设计。
- 优化网页性能。
四、总结
学习web前端课程,掌握实战技巧对于初学者来说至关重要。通过本文的介绍,相信读者对web前端课程有了更深入的了解,并为今后的学习和发展奠定了基础。在实践过程中,不断总结和积累经验,相信你将在这个领域取得优异的成绩。
